Abstract
The paper analyzes a continuous and discrete version of the Neumann-Neumann domain decomposition algorithm for two-body contact problems with Tresca friction. Each iterative step consists of a linear elasticity problem for one body with displacements prescribed on a contact part of the boundary and a contact problem with Tresca friction for the second body. To ensure continuity of contact stresses, two auxiliary Neumann problems in each domain are solved. Numerical experiments illustrate the performace of the proposed approach.
